Yanchuang Capital
Yanchuang Capital is a platform co-sponsored by Peking University alumni for venture capital and university technological achievement transformation. It was established under the support of Peking University's Science and Technology Development Department. Yanchuang Capital has made 31 investments, including a Series A - VI investment in VOLANT on December 30, 2024.

Frequently asked questions
What investment stages does Yanchuang Capital target?
Yanchuang Capital pursues a multi-stage strategy that begins at seed and early-stage venture, continues through expansion and late-stage growth, and extends into pre-IPO rounds and buyouts. This full-lifecycle mandate is uncommon among Chinese private equity firms, which typically specialize in either early-stage venture or late-stage control transactions. The firm can therefore enter a company's cap table at formation and maintain its position through multiple funding rounds.
Is Yanchuang Capital a venture capital firm or a private equity firm?
Yanchuang Capital operates as both, depending on the asset. The firm manages venture strategies for early-stage and growth investments alongside buyout strategies for control transactions. This dual-structure approach places it in a hybrid category — part venture capital, part private equity — which is reflected in its stage coverage spanning seed through pre-IPO and buyout.
